What are my cheap ticket options for Kidsgrove to Farnborough North journeys?

From booking in Advance, to our FairSplits, here are our tips for you to find the best price

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kidsgrove to Farnborough North start from as little as £49.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kidsgrove to Farnborough North start from £78.90 one way, or £112.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kidsgrove to Farnborough North are available for £120.20 one way, or £240.20 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Passenger Support at Kidsgrove Station

For those requiring assistance, help points offer a direct line to staff during the same hours as the ticket office. Though staff can't physically aid in boarding, they can provide assistance over the phone. Bear in mind, accessible features are somewhat limited, yet the station does accommodate step-free access to platforms via lifts and footbridges—an often overlooked but essential feature for passengers with mobility considerations. Heated waiting rooms can be found on Platforms 1 and 2/3, and a sheltered seating area is available on Platform 4.

While Kidsgrove Station may not boast a plethora of amenities, it does include basic conveniences such as toilets within the booking hall, though these are not accessible for those with disabilities. If you're in the mood for a bite to eat or looking to grab a quick coffee, you might need to plan ahead as the station offers no in-house refreshment options or shops. However, being a key point on the East Midlands Railway network, it does ensure a Safe environment—CCTV is present not only in the station but also over the bicycle storage areas.

Your Travel Connections at Kidsgrove Station

The station is well-linked with various modes of onward travel. If your journey extends beyond the rail, local taxi services such as Kidsgrove and C and M taxis offer convenient transportation options right from the station. In the case of rail disruptions, a rail replacement service bus will collect passengers at the station's car park entrance. Onward Travel and Accessibility

Farnborough North station is more than just a gateway to the rail network. While the station lacks its own taxi rank, the nearby junction of Ship Lane and Farnborough Street offers a convenient rail replacement service should you need it. For bus connections, plan your route with the available printable transport guide here. If you're en route to the airport, the station is strategically placed for a short transfer to Reading for services to Heathrow and Gatwick or hop onto a connection at Bristol Temple Meads for Bristol Airport.

Bicycles are warmly welcomed, with 20 storage spaces and CCTV ensuring security. Though hire services aren't provided directly at the station, the assurance of bringing your own cycles for free is an appealing option. With its 24-hour car park that even offers free parking, despite the limited five-space capacity, it's a convenient choice for those arriving by car.
